外膜蛋白在淋病奈瑟菌P9于豚鼠皮下腔室内存活中的作用

The role of outer membrane proteins in the survival of Neisseria gonorrhoeae P9 within guinea-pig subcutaneous chambers.

作者信息

McBride H M, Lambden P R, Heckels J E, Watt P J

出版信息

J Gen Microbiol. 1981 Sep;126(1):63-7. doi: 10.1099/00221287-126-1-63.

DOI:10.1099/00221287-126-1-63
PMID:6801194
Abstract

Guinea-pig subcutaneous chambers were infected with a mixture of gonococcal variants of defined outer membrane protein profile. Survival within the chambers was a two-stage process. The initial advantage conferred by the lack of opacity-related outer membrane protein was transient and survivors were replaced by opaque colonial variants. Amongst these survivors were variants which produced opacity-related proteins (IId, IIe and IIf) not present in the initial inoculum. Thus, outer membrane protein composition is an important factor in survival in vivo.
